Understanding Title Issues and Their Impact on Realty Deals
When you're browsing a real estate purchase, recognizing title problems is important, as they can substantially impact your financial investment.
Title concerns can arise from numerous sources, such as conflicts over ownership, overdue taxes, or errors in public records. These issues can delay your purchase or perhaps result in financial loss.
You need to perform a complete title search, ensuring there are no concealed insurance claims versus the home. If you discover prospective title issues, addressing them quickly is important.
Consulting a property attorney can give assistance on settling these problems properly. By remaining notified and aggressive, you can guard your investment and ensure a smooth closing process.

Navigating Liens: Types and Resolution Techniques
Although liens can make complex realty deals, understanding their types and exactly how to resolve them is essential for protecting your financial investment.
There are numerous types of liens you might experience, consisting of home loan liens, tax obligation liens, and technicians' liens. Each kind has distinct effects for your home.
To resolve a lien, beginning by recognizing its nature and the financial institution entailed. You might discuss straight with the lienholder to work out the financial debt or arrange a layaway plan.
If needed, take into consideration seeking legal help to ensure your rights are secured. In some cases, a lien can be gotten rid of via a court procedure, however this can be prolonged and expensive.
Being proactive regarding liens aids secure your home and financial investment.
